Overview

This volume of High Performance Computing in Science and Engineering is fully dedicated to the final report of KONWIHR, the Bavarian Competence Network for Technical and Scientific High Performance Computing. It includes the transactions of the final KONWIHR workshop, that was held at Technische Universität München, October 14-15, 2004, as well as additional reports of KONWIHR research groups. KONWIHR was established by the Bavarian State Government in order to support the broad application of high performance computing in science and technology throughout the country. KONWIHR is a supporting action to the installation of the German supercomputer Hitachi SR 8000 in the Leibniz Computing Center of the Bavarian Academy of Sciences. The report covers projects from basic research in computer science to develop tools for high performance computing as well as applications from biology, chemistry, electrical engineering, geology, mathematics, physics, computational fluid dynamics, materials science and computer science.
